Research Productivity on Fish and Fishing industry in India

2014 
Received 11 May 2013; Revised 08 Aug 2013; Accepted 20 Aug 2013 ABSTRACT This study examines the Research Productivity on Fish and Fishing Industry by Indian scientist in which published literature on fisheries growth trend accounted. In 1980, Fish research output was 370 at the national level and it rose to 3971 by the end of 2009, which was a phenomenal increase in numbers. It helps to contribute to economic growth at national and local Levels, with examples from the Fisheries Management Science Programme (FMSP), and considers the Implications for fisheries policy in developing countries.
